Thrilling weekend ahead for the Infantiles and Cadetes
The Infantil A is seeking the Andalusian Club Championship in Villanueva del Trabuco. On an international level, MCF’s Cadetes from 2004 are in Prague taking part in the Slavia International Cup 2019.
Infantil
Dani Medina (above image) will be trying to emulate the Alevín 2ª Andaluza, who won the Andalusian Championship last week in Torrox. The Blue and Whites, Group 2 league champions, are fighting for the title against Sevilla FC, Real Betis Balompié and Granada CF. The Green and Whites are Málaga CF’s rival in the semi-finals.
The ‘El Saladillo’ Municipal Stadium - artificial pitch - in Villanueva del Trabuco, an inland municipality in the province, is hosting the exciting final phase of the competition with the following match schedule:
Friday 17th May
17:30 – MÁLAGA CF - Real Betis Balompié
19:15 – Sevilla FC - Granada CF
Saturday 18th May
18:00 – 3rd and 4th place
19:45 – Final
Cadete
The MCF Academy still has representation overseas, and this time around it’s an Under-15 Cadete team in action. Málaga CF is participating in the Slavia International Cup taking place between 17th and 19th May in the Czech Republic capital of Prague.
In Group B of the competition, the Malaguista rivals are China’s national team, Tottenham Hotspur FC and NK Lokomotiva Zagreb. Group A is made up of local side, SK Slavia Prague, Sanfrecce Hiroshima FC, Juventus de Turín and Beijing FC.
